Fort Myers woman arrested after dunking child in resort pool out on bond

TUESDAY NIGHT UPDATE: After an appearance in front of a judge Tuesday morning, Tiffany Griffith, who had been held since her Friday arrest on no bond, was issued a $20,000 after the court found the state did not meet the burden of proof to keep her held on no bond.

Still rolling into Christmas — $1.7 billion now up for grabs in Powerball

TUESDAY UPDATE: Now we've got a potential billion-dollar drawing on Christmas Eve.Nobody matched all the Powerball number Monday night — the white balls of 3-18-36-41-54 and the red Powerball of 7. Nine tickets around the country did match all the while balls, including one sold in Florida.

Stand Your Ground ruling clears Osceola man; Child sex charges pending

A Poinciana man has been cleared of a manslaughter charge in a May shooting after a judge found he acted in self-defense, but he still faces unrelated child sex charges.
